Threat To Saraki's Life: Kwara PDP Faults Police Claims

Date: 2019-01-13

The Peoples Democratic Party(PDP) in Kwara state has faulted claims by the state's police command that the party never reported cases of assault on its members to any police station in the state.

The party, in a statement made available to newsmen last night described the police position as another validation of the alarm the party’s national leader and Senate President, Dr. Bukola Saraki raised on Friday that the police has become a partisan arbiter in the politics of the state.

According to the statement signed by the state publicity secretary of the PDP, Tunde Ashaolu, available evidences indicated that the party had not raised a false alarm as it submitted several reports on the attacks on its members by suspected thugs of the APC who unleashed violence on PDP members on Thursday.

The Kwara state police command had on Saturday issued a statement personally signed by the Kwara state commissioner of police, Bashir Makama, where it claimed that Saraki’s allegations that his life and those of his supporters were in danger in the state were unsubstantiated.

But, the PDP in its response to the police claims said it submitted a petition titled" Attack on the lives of Mr Mumini Ambali and Mr Aremo Fatai by armed thugs of factional APC loyal to AbdulRahman AbdulRasaq on the orders of Musibau Eshinrogunjo, Yahaya Seriki and Ibrahim Labaika at Adewole ward, Ilorin" dated January 11,2019 to the office of the Kwara state police commissioner.

The petition was signed by the party's State Legal Adviser, O.M Aborishade(Esq).

It said the petition was received and acknowledged by the office of Kwara state police commissioner and a copy of the petition, duly signed and stamped by the receiver was given to the PDP officials by the police.

The PDP added that " we also submitted another petition titled " Petition Against The Destruction of Campaign Posters and Banners " dated January 11, 2019 to the office of the Kwara.
